Professional Experience
Engineering robust systems, automated pipelines, and intelligent architectures.
Jul 2024 - Present
Singapore
Software Engineer
AvePoint (Client: GIC)
Jul 2024 - Present Singapore
- Engineered an automated ingestion system ('FeedProc') using Python and SQL to seamlessly process and integrate BlackRock Solutions (BRS) financial factor files into the NeoXam Datahub platform.
- Developed full-stack data management features, including a bulk Excel upload engine and an intuitive UI dashboard to streamline user data operations.
- Architected automated data validation and alerting frameworks to intercept data discrepancies during runtime, guaranteeing 100% data integrity for downstream systems.
- Optimized ingestion pipelines handling large-scale market data from global providers including Bloomberg, Refinitiv, and ICE.
Nov 2022 - Jun 2024
Singapore
Test Development & Automation Engineer
Helius Technologies (Client: NCS)
Nov 2022 - Jun 2024 Singapore
- Designed and built an enterprise API Automation Test Framework using JavaScript and Newman for the IRIN3 P3 financial module, fully integrated into Azure DevOps CI/CD pipelines.
- Developed system-level utility scripts (PowerShell) to synthetically generate mock bank mainframe files, reducing integration testing cycle times significantly.
- Automated internal engineering workflows by leveraging Microsoft Azure APIs to auto-collect system evidence, removing manual overhead.
May 2021 - Sep 2022
Singapore
QA Automation Engineer
SeaMoney
May 2021 - Sep 2022 Singapore
- Programmed core payment API automation frameworks utilizing Golang and Python to validate high-throughput transactional systems.
- Contributed to frontend feature development using React.js and TypeScript for internal engineering interfaces.
- Managed continuous integration workflows, environment deployments, and version control using Jenkins, Git, and Linux environments.